
A new wave of conversation is brewing in poker forums about whether historical names boost interest in the game. Recent discussions center on how seeing beloved long-deceased names, like George Washington, on waiting lists can entice or deter players.
The initial post that sparked this interest asked if changing oneโs name on the poker list to a famous individual would make people more eager to join the game, or lead to disappointment when expectations arenโt met. This notion is lively due to the unique mix of sentiment around nostalgia and gaming.
Expectations and Disappointment
Many participants expressed concerns that the novelty of a famous name could lead to letdowns. One participant humorously noted, "Iโd be surprised if a guy who literally died before I was born showed up to play the game." The fear is real: will the experience match the name?
The Role of Humor
Playful banter dominated the threads, with many suggesting ridiculous scenarios. One standout quote captured this whimsy: "If George Washington is on the list, I want the seat to his left. Man cannot tell a lie, so his ranges are face up." Such imaginative takes on the game keep the atmosphere lively.
Authenticity Matters
Amidst the humor, the need for authenticity was a recurring concern. Comments revealed that while many can appreciate a themed approach, others cringe at the thought of false pretenses. Skepticism remains a roadblock to fully embracing this format in poker rooms.
